Output ca9905d33dee265a5869837ba38e40f38f87b16052ae920e00bbf3abe9316b9e:3

value
424883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809624088305d7e4a2e9e615d443ec9fa4a90f2f OP_EQUAL
address
3DQvH4U3mcC9Q57JrdGKTdnexdEK734JBW
transaction
ca9905d33dee265a5869837ba38e40f38f87b16052ae920e00bbf3abe9316b9e